Second Thoughts

John_koch For those who are unaware, John Koch is one of a small set of Minnesota bridge players who have earned national titles.  John, along with partner Tony Ames and teammates Rod Beery and Mary Egan, won the Senior Knockouts in a tough field.

Today, John presents us with a hand where he made an "impossible" game.  Had John not calculated how to bring this one home, two of our national champs would not have won their titles!  The column has several good lessons.  Taking them to heart will improve any game.

You might also note that with this column, John has produced fifty such for the Minnesota Bridge Blog.  I'm sure that I can add my voice to that of many others in offering John an enormous "thank you" for the education, entertainment and wisdom he has been donating to us!
